Ousedale Secondary School

The proposed facility, developed in association with the National Energy Foundation, provides a laboratory, ICT Room, Greenhouse, dedicated external planting & studies areas, and incorporates numerous renewable technologies - all essential for the delivery of the land based diploma.

In terms of sustainability, the goal of the Ousedale Land Based Diploma facility project was to design the ‘Greenest’ possible building within the parameters of the Councils available construction budget, thus allowing the School to use the building itself as an educational tool to teach students about the impact of construction on the environment, renewable technologies, thermal insulation, carbon emissions, etc
